This 47.6-mile journey from Manasquan, NJ, to Elizabethport, NJ, is a quick drive, estimated to take just over an hour. Designed as a single-day trip, it primarily utilizes major highways, with 80% of the route focused on high-speed driving. You'll navigate using the Garden State Parkway and the New Jersey Turnpike, with a brief stint on Atlantic Avenue. The estimated fuel cost for this drive is around $8. Given its short distance and highway-centric profile, this route is ideal for a straightforward transit between these two Northeast locations without the need for an overnight stay.

Expect a highway-focused drive for the majority of this trip, with 80% of the route consisting of high-speed roads. The longest uninterrupted stretch you'll encounter is 30.5 miles on the Garden State Parkway, offering a consistent pace. While primarily on major thoroughfares like the Garden State Parkway and New Jersey Turnpike, you'll also experience a segment on Atlantic Avenue, which might offer a slight variation in driving experience before rejoining the faster roads. The overall character is one of efficient travel between points.
